What is duress of circumstances?
A
Where D has committed a crime because the situation forces them to act in order to avoid death/serious injury
R v Willer

Test for whether D acted reasonably?
A
In R v Martin - Graham test was put forward
1. Was the D compelled to act because she reasonably believed she had good cause to fear serious violence?
2. If so, would a sober person of reasonable firmness and sharing the characteristics of the accused have responded the same way?

What crimes can duress of circumstances not be used for and case which confirms this?
A
R v Pommell — murder, attempted murder and treason
